About Warren Joyce

Warren Joyce is a scholar working on Global and Planetary Change, Nature and Landscape Conservation, Aquatic Science, Oceanography and Molecular Biology, having authored 14 papers that have together received 481 indexed citations. Recurring topics across this work include Marine and fisheries research (13 papers), Ichthyology and Marine Biology (11 papers), Fish Ecology and Management Studies (11 papers), Marine Bivalve and Aquaculture Studies (2 papers), Fish Biology and Ecology Studies (2 papers), Marine and coastal plant biology (2 papers) and Identification and Quantification in Food (1 paper). The work is most often cited by research in Nature and Landscape Conservation (429 citations), Aquatic Science (108 citations), Global and Planetary Change (293 citations), Ecology (132 citations) and Oceanography (22 citations). Warren Joyce has collaborated with scholars based in Canada, United States and Portugal. Frequent co-authors include Steven E. Campana, Mark Fowler, Linda Marks, Nancy E. Kohler, Zeliang Wang, Igor Yashayaev, Lisa J. Natanson, Heather D. Bowlby, Megan V. Winton and Sigmund Myklevoll. Their work appears in journals such as Canadian Journal of Fisheries and Aquatic Sciences, Fishery Bulletin, ICES Journal of Marine Science, North American Journal of Fisheries Management and Fisheries Research.
